While driving 30mph & started to smell an odor inside vehicle. Smoke was coming through the vents. Pulled to side of road & retrieved the fire extinguisher. After leaving vehicle, it was engulfed in flames. Fire department called & put out flames. Was extensive damage done to vehicle. Fire department suspected fire was caused by a short in electrical wirings, but not definite due to damage.
Vehicle experiencing problem with lower cover of the streeing column overheating from the inside of vehicle. Believed this condition is a result of ignition wiring runing through the cover. Cover was removed and connector was cleaned off and cover replaced. But condition still occurs whenever the fan to the A/C is used. Dealer/manufacturer were not notified at this time.
